Brugal is one of the great names of Dominican rum, founded in Puerto Plata in 1888 by Andrés Brugal. The brand remains closely associated with the Dominican Republic, where it is a market leader, and with a house style traditionally described as lighter, cleaner and drier than many richer, heavier Caribbean rums.

Today Brugal is part of Edrington, the Scottish spirits group also associated with The Macallan and Highland Park. Production remains rooted in the Dominican Republic, with Brugal’s ageing and blending expertise carried forward through generations of maestros roneros. The range includes accessible expressions such as Añejo and Extra Viejo, alongside more premium bottlings including XV, 1888, Leyenda and limited-edition releases.

The style is generally smooth, dry and oak-led, with notes of vanilla, caramel, orange peel, toasted sugar, light spice and polished wood. Brugal 1888, one of the brand’s key premium expressions, is double aged in American oak and sherry-seasoned casks, adding richer layers of dried fruit, cocoa, spice and soft sweetness while retaining the brand’s relatively clean Dominican profile.

Brugal offers a polished route into Dominican rum: elegant, versatile and less overtly sugary than many modern sipping styles. Its best bottlings combine Caribbean warmth with a restrained, cask-led character that works well in both simple mixed drinks and more contemplative serves.
